Scott Dann: 'Crystal Palace confident ahead of Everton clash'

Crystal Palace defender Scott Dann admits that his side are full of confidence ahead of their trip to Everton as they look for the third win on the bounce at Goodison Park.

Crystal Palace defender Scott Dann has revealed that he and his teammates are confident ahead of their Premier League clash against Everton.

The Eagles have won on their previous two trips to face the Toffees, and Dann believes that his side's good form on the road this season has given them belief that they can extend their winning run at Goodison Park.

He told the club's official website: "We've got a strong record up there, and over the last couple of years we've enjoyed some good victories.

"I think the way we play away from home gives us a chance to make it three away wins in a row, so we're looking forward to Monday night. We've had a tough run of games up until this point, but the way we've played away from home against the big teams shows us that we can get results.

"I think we can be happy with where we are in the league. The past two seasons we haven't started so well and have then come strong at the end of the season, so if we can build on what we've done already then hopefully we can be pushing teams like Everton come the end."

Palace are eighth in the Premier League ahead of their clash against Roberto Martinez's men.
